Discount Policy for Large Deals (Managers Only)

For opportunities above the Tier 3 threshold, branch managers may approve discounts up to 15% on Sollmark products. Anything higher requires sign-off from regional director Hest Varano. Stacking promotional and volume discounts is not permitted. Quarterly exceptions are tracked centrally and reviewed. The reasoning behind the tighter cap is noted below.

management briefing: Project Ulavan slips by two quarters because of the staffing delay.

This memo confirms the planned 15% reduction to the marketing budget for the coming fiscal year. Savings come primarily from ending the Crestwane sponsorship and consolidating agency work under a single retainer. Digital acquisition spend is protected, and the Hollybeck product launch remains fully funded. Finance projects minimal impact on revenue targets, with quarterly monitoring in place to catch any softening in demand. Further context on forward plans appears in the confidential note below.

board note of tadup-tajog: Headcount on the Oliiel team goes from 31 to 88 by the end of February. Gross margin on Oliiel came in at 62 percent against a plan of 29 percent.

Action item: map-tile prefetcher cache bound (Wayfern incident)

Owner: platform team. The Wayfern prefetcher filled disk on three edge nodes, degrading map loads for two hours. Fix: enforce a hard cache ceiling and evict by region age. Support should flag any repeat reports of blank tiles as possible recurrence. Status updates and the rollout schedule are tracked on the page below.

wiki page, bageg-kahif: https://gitlab.qorvellabs.internal/view/spaces/job/2a5e7e5f1a93